36 faces. 36 journeys. One shared goal: to rebalance what we see in public space.
Presented by the association Les Romandes and created by photographer Chloé Bonnard, Voices of equALLity is a free, traveling urban photography exhibition crossing four cities in French-speaking Switzerland. It highlights 36 Romandy personalities—sociologists, journalists, winegrowers, artists, entrepreneurs, mechanics—committed to a more just society and addressing themes still too often made invisible.
Each large-format portrait is accompanied by a powerful phrase and a QR code providing access to a filmed interview capsule of the portrayed personality.
Because what we see shapes what we believe is possible.
